Although the price is not cheap, considering its high quality of food and service, such consumption is definitely worth it. 💰 🛬【Local must-visit】 Tayelet Promenade: One of the symbols of Tel Aviv, the 14-kilometer seaside trail is picturesque along the way. It is a good place for walking, cycling or enjoying the sea breeze. 🚴‍♀️🌅 Tel Aviv White City: A complex of historical buildings that attracts countless tourists with its unique European architectural style. This is the farthest point reached by the European modernist art movement and is listed as a World Cultural Heritage by UNESCO. 🏛️📚 👉【Itinerary】 Morning: Start from Shenkin Hotel and walk to Tayelet Promenade to start your seaside stroll.
